R48 ALS is a 1998 Tvr Griffith 500 in Red with a 4,988c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 21 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 95.2%.
Across all 1998 Tvr Griffith 500 models, the average MOT pass rate is 83.0% with a typical mileage of 36,352 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Tvr Griffith 500 fails its MOT is headlamp aim too high, accounting for 200 recorded failures. If you're considering buying R48 ALS,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Tvr Griffith 500 typically stays on UK roads for around 34 years. At 28 years old, this Tvr Griffith 500 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
